The Experience Breakdown: What to Expect on the 2-Day Alisa Cruise

Hanoi: 2-Day Halong Bay on 5-Star Alisa Cruise with Balcony - The Experience Breakdown: What to Expect on the 2-Day Alisa Cruise

Convenient Pickups and Transfers

The tour begins with a pickup from your hotel or a designated meeting point in Hanoi, usually around 8:00 AM. If you’re staying outside the Old Quarter, the meeting point at Hanoi Opera House ensures everyone is on board. The limousine bus transfer (roundtrip) is an added bonus, providing a comfortable ride that sets a relaxed tone for the adventure ahead.

The roughly 2.5-hour drive offers a chance to prepare for the scenery ahead and possibly exchange travel tips with fellow travelers. It’s a smooth start that minimizes the logistical stress often associated with day tours.

Day 1: Scenic Cruising and Cave Exploration

Arrival at Tuan Chau Marina marks the official beginning of the cruise. You’ll be greeted onboard with a welcome drink, and after a brief safety briefing, the boat sets sail into the stunning bay. The first highlight is a leisurely lunch in a luxury restaurant on deck, where fresh seafood and Vietnamese dishes are served. Many reviews praise the quality of the food, emphasizing how well it matches the luxurious vibe of the cruise.

Next, the boat anchors at Bo Hon Island for a visit to Sung Sot (Surprising) Cave. This is the largest and most famous cave in Halong Bay, accessible via a walk of about 200 steps through lush forest. The cave’s interior is a labyrinth of stalactites and stalagmites, with a reputation for being breathtakingly beautiful. Visitors often comment that the guide’s explanations added depth to the experience, with one reviewer mentioning “insightful explanations from our bilingual guide.”

In the late afternoon, activities shift to kayaking or bamboo boat rides around Luon Cave. The calm waters and towering limestone formations create a picture-perfect setting. Travelers should be mindful of their belongings like phones and cameras, as reviews advise caution during water activities. As the sun begins to set, the cruise provides an ideal moment to unwind on the deck, sipping a cocktail as the sky turns a painter’s palette of colors.

Day 2: Island Adventures and Return to Hanoi

Early risers can enjoy breakfast with a view before heading to Ti Top Island. Here, swimming and hiking are popular, with clear waters perfect for a quick dip, and a trail leading to panoramic viewpoints. Reviewers suggest bringing essentials like swimwear, sun protection, and small cash for snacks or souvenirs. Many mention how the scenic hike offers a rewarding vista over the bay.

After returning to the boat, guests will check out around 9:45 AM, with luggage being transferred to the jetty. The cruise team assists with luggage management, making the disembarkation process smooth and organized. The return trip to Hanoi usually arrives mid-afternoon, with drop-offs in the Old Quarter, leaving travelers ample time to explore or relax afterward.

Frequently Asked Questions

Hanoi: 2-Day Halong Bay on 5-Star Alisa Cruise with Balcony - Frequently Asked Questions

What’s included in the tour price?
The $290 fee covers all meals, a night on a luxury cruise, limousine transfers between Hanoi and Halong Bay, sightseeing fees, activities like kayaking and cave visits, and guided commentary.

Can dietary restrictions be accommodated?
Yes, the tour can accommodate v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free, and other dietary needs if specified at booking.

What activities are on offer during the cruise?
Guests can enjoy kayaking or bamboo boat rides, swimming, hiking at Ti Top Island, squid fishing, and relaxing on the deck during sunset.

How long is the transfer from Hanoi to Halong Bay?
The drive takes about 2.5 hours, with pickup starting early in the morning around 8:00 AM to ensure ample time for activities.

Is the cruise suitable for solo travelers?
Absolutely. The tour is designed for groups up to 48 people, making it a great social experience for solo travelers and small groups alike.

What happens in case of bad weather?
The tour relies on good weather; if canceled due to poor conditions, travelers will be offered a different date or a full refund.
